Abstract
Some limitations to the operation of a CCD TV camera sensor at low light levels are discussed. Transfer inefficiency with small charge packets is analyzed theoretically, and the prediction made that with good processing this should not be a serious problem. The principal limitation is seen to be the output amplifier, and a new low-noise output detector, the "floating surface detector," is described in detail. At -50°C it yields a noise equivalent signal of 16 electrons and a dynamic range of 85 dB over a 1-MHz video bandwidth.Keywords
